Reading have been linked with another swoop for Everton youngster Reece Welch, 12 months on from their first reported interest.

The 21-year-old has spent over a decade rising through the ranks at Goodison Park but is finding game time hard to come by with the Premier League giants.

An England Under-20 international, the youngster spent the first half of 2023/24 on loan with Forest Green Rovers and managed 23 appearances during his short spell in Gloucestershire.

In September 2024, the defender moved to Belgian side Deinze but he managed just two appearances before returning to Merseyside in December and the club went bankrupt.

With two Toffees appearances under his belt but none since 2022/23, Welch has now entered the final year of his contract.

[According to Football Insider,](https://www.footballinsider247.com/everton-reading-reece-welch-premier-league-league-one-david-moyes-noel-hunt/) the Royals have registered their interest in the youngster for the second summer in a row. The difference from last year being that the club can now operate freely in the transfer market after the the end of their transfer embargo.

The Royals are likely to be targeting a central defender, having had a trialist play in the second half of Saturday's 5-1 win over Hungerford Town to kick off pre-season.
